The History and 1923 Currency
The appearance of 1923 banknotes holds significant place in German history , reflecting the economic crisis that plagued the republic following its War I. Issued by the Reichsbank , these notes were initially valued at par with the U.S. dollar, however quickly diminished their value as prices spiraled upward control. Owning 1923 currency today is isn't a compelling hobby among numismatists also provides the reminder about a volatile period for German economic development and its lasting social impact .

Rare Finds: Detecting Valuable 1923 Money
Unearthing a old 1923 money piece can be incredibly exciting , but recognizing what makes it worthwhile requires careful inspection . Several factors influence the worth of these coins, including the stamp , the coin’s condition , and its scarcity . Common 1923 pieces are generally relatively low-cost, but certain varieties, such as those created in the Denver Mint , or those in exceptional shape , can command high prices at sale . Here’s what to check:
- Examine the stamp: A "D" indicates the Denver Mint , a "P" Philadelphia, and no mark signifies the Philadelphia Mint . Denver's coins are usually more uncommon.
- Assess the shape : Assessing ranges from Poor to Mint State, with better grades bringing greater values .
- Investigate any unusual marks : Imperfections or variations in the artwork can dramatically boost the piece's price.
Always to seek the guidance of an experienced coin collector for a reliable assessment.
